Figure VI.1 shows the
organization chart for the Center. There have been no significant changes to
the proposed organizational structure since November 1, 1999 though some
specific personnel changes have been made. Dr. Everett I. Baucom filled the
position of Deputy Director on January 1, 2000, after 30 years with E. I. du
Pont de Nemours. Several support staff
were added, including an administrative assistant, an accountant, and a
computer specialist to assist with updating our website and with
teleconferencing. There were several
leadership changes in the thrust areas.
V. N. Kabadi assumed leadership of Thrust Area B, partly in an attempt
to provide NCA&T a stronger role in the Center. J. M. DeSimone and G. W. Roberts temporarily joined R. M. Kelly
as leaders of Thrust Area D.
